سرعت سایت عامل تعیین کننده ای است که می تواند تجربه کاربری را به سرعت بهبود ببخشد و به صورت مستقیم روی سئوی سایت تاثیر بگذارد. وقتی صفحه ها سریع لود می شوند، کاربران احساس راحتی و اعتماد بیشتری پیدا می کنند، نرخ پرش کاهش می یابد و احتمال تبدیل (Conversion) بالاتر می رود. این نوشته به شکلی دوستانه و کاربردی به اهمیت سرعت سایت، اندازه گیری آن، تاثیرش روی تجربه کاربری و سئو و روش های عملی برای بهینه سازی می پردازد.
چرا سرعت سایت این قدر مهم است
تجربه کاربری: صفحات کند آزاردهنده هستند. کاربران امروزی انتظار دارند صفحات در چند ثانیه یا کمتر بارگذاری شوند. سرعت پایین باعث خستگی و بی اعتمادی می شود و کاربران سریعاً به سایت رقیب مراجعه می کنند.
نرخ تبدیل و درآمد: هر ثانیه تاخیر می تواند درآمد را کاهش دهد. مثال های واقعی شرکت ها نشان داده اند با کاهش زمان بارگذاری، نرخ تبدیل و فروش آنلاین به طور محسوسی افزایش می یابد.
سئو و رتبه بندی: گوگل سرعت صفحه و مجموعه معیارهای تجربه کاربری (Core Web Vitals) را به عنوان سیگنال هایی در رتبه بندی صفحات در نظر می گیرد. هرچند محتوا و بک لینک ها اهمیت بالایی دارند، بهبود سرعت می تواند تفاوت افزایش رتبه در نتایج جستجو را رقم بزند.
Core Web Vitals: معیارهای اصلی گوگل گوگل سه معیار اصلی را به عنوان Core Web Vitals معرفی کرده که باید جدی گرفته شوند:
LCP (Largest Contentful Paint): زمان بارگذاری بزرگ ترین آیتم محتوایی قابل مشاهده در صفحه. هدف زیر 2.5 ثانیه است.
FID یا INP (First Input Delay / Interaction to Next Paint): تاخیر اولیه در پاسخ به تعامل کاربر. هدف کمتر از 100 میلی ثانیه برای FID است؛ گوگل اخیراً INP را نیز به کار می گیرد.
CLS (Cumulative Layout Shift): مقدار جابجایی های غیرمنتظره در چینش صفحه. هدف مقدار کمتر از 0.1 است.
این سه معیار ترکیبی از سرعت بارگذاری، پاسخ دهی به تعامل و پایداری بصری را اندازه می گیرند و تاثیر مستقیمی روی تجربه واقعی کاربران دارند.
ابزارهای سنجش سرعت و تجربه کاربری برای دریافت دید دقیق از وضعیت سایت، چند ابزار کلیدی وجود دارد:
Google PageSpeed Insights: تحلیل دقیق و پیشنهادات عملی برای بهبود سرعت و Core Web Vitals.
Lighthouse (در کروم): گزارش کامل شامل فرصت ها و مشکلات.
Chrome DevTools (تَب Network و Performance): بررسی بارگذاری منابع و تحلیل waterfall.
GTmetrix و WebPageTest: بررسی از محل های مختلف، و ارائه داده های عمیق.
کنسول جستجوی گوگل (Search Console): گزارش Core Web Vitals برای صفحات سایت و هشدارها.
بهینه سازی سرعت: راهکارهای عملی و اولویت بندی برای بهبود سرعت سایت، لازم است ترکیبی از تغییرات در سمت سرور، شبکه و فرانت اند انجام شود. در ادامه یک چک لیست عملی با اولویت ها آورده شده:
انتخاب هاست مناسب و بهینه سازی سرور
از هاست با منابع کافی استفاده شود؛ انواع اشتراکی ارزان ممکن است باعث کندی شوند.
زمان پاسخ دهی سرور (TTFB) را کاهش دهید. استفاده از PHP-FPM، به روزرسانی نسخه PHP، و تنظیمات کش سطح سرور کمک می کند.
استفاده از HTTP/2 یا HTTP/3 برای بهبود انتقال همزمان منابع.
استفاده از CDN (شبکه توزیع محتوا)
CDN محتوا را از سرورهای نزدیک به کاربران ارائه می دهد، تاخیر را کاهش و سرعت بارگذاری را بالا می برد.
فایل های استاتیک مانند تصاویر، CSS و JS را از CDN ارائه کنید.
فشرده سازی و بهینه سازی منابع
Gzip یا Brotli را برای فشرده سازی فایل های متنی فعال کنید.
CSS و JS را مینیمایز کنید و فایل ها را کوچک کنید.
فایل های CSS و JS غیرضروری را حذف یا به بعد از بارگذاری اولیه منتقل کنید (defer یا async).
بهینه سازی تصاویر
تصویر را در فرمت مناسب (WebP یا AVIF) قرار دهید.
اندازه تصاویر را با توجه به سایز نمایش بارگذاری کنید (Responsive images به کمک srcset).
از lazy loading برای تصاویر پایین صفحه استفاده کنید تا بار اولیه سبک شود.
کاهش درخواست های HTTP و ترکیب منابع
ترکیب فایل های CSS و JS مگر در مواردی که HTTP/2 استفاده می شود و تقسیم منطقی بهتر باشد.
حذف فونت ها و اسکریپت های خارجی غیرضروری.
کشینگ (Caching)
فعال سازی کش مرورگر با هدرهای مناسب (Cache-Control، Expire).
استفاده از caching در سطح سرور یا پلاگین های معتبر (برای وردپرس: WP Rocket، W3 Total Cache).
حذف پلاگین ها و اسکریپت های سنگین
بررسی پلاگین ها و حذف یا غیرفعال کردن مواردی که بار اضافی ایجاد می کنند.
بارگذاری اسکریپت های تحلیلی یا تبلیغاتی به صورت آسنکرون یا تاخیری.
بهینه سازی فونت ها
بارگذاری فونت ها با فرمت های بهینه و استفاده از preload برای فونت های حیاتی.
کاهش تعداد وزن های فونت و استفاده از font-display: swap برای جلوگیری از تأخیر در نمایش متن.
کاهش CLS با رزرو فضا برای رسانه ها
برای تصاویر و ویدیوها عرض و ارتفاع یا aspect-ratio مشخص کنید تا از جابجایی محتوا جلوگیری شود.
اجتناب از درج محتوای دینامیک بدون جاپذیری اولیه.
بارگذاری تدریجی و نمایش اسکلت (Skeleton UI)
نمایش نمایشگرهای اسکلت به جای نمایش سفید باعث احساس سرعت بیشتر می شود.
لود قسمت های حیاتی اولویت دار (Critical Rendering Path) و تاخیر بارگذاری بقیه بخش ها.
یک تجربه واقعی در پروژه ای که روی یک فروشگاه آنلاین کار کردم، صفحات محصول حدود 6 ثانیه طول می کشید تا کامل بارگذاری شوند. با اجرای مراحل زیر:
بهینه سازی تصاویر و تبدیل به WebP،
فعال سازی CDN،
миниمизация فایل های CSS/JS،
تنظیم کش مرورگر، زمان بارگذاری به زیر 2.5 ثانیه رسید و LCP به طور محسوسی بهبود یافت. نتیجه: نرخ پرش کاهش و فروش روزانه افزایش پیدا کرد. این مثال نشان می دهد چند تغییر نسبتاً ساده می تواند تاثیر اقتصادی قابل توجهی داشته باشد.
اولویت بندی برای سایت های مختلف
سایت های خبری: تمرکز بر LCP و CLS؛ تصاویر و تبلیغات باید کنترل شوند.
فروشگاه های آنلاین: بهینه سازی صفحات محصول و فرایند پرداخت؛ سرعت در صفحات موبایل حیاتی است.
بلاگ ها و محتوای آموزشی: تصاویر و فونت ها مهم هستند؛ lazy loading و caching بسیار موثرند.
سئو و سرعت: رابطه ای فراتر از رتبه بندی سرعت سایت مستقیماً سیگنال رتبه بندی است، اما ارزش واقعی از طریق بهبود رفتار کاربران تجلی می یابد: زمان بیشتر در سایت، صفحات دیده شده بیشتر و نرخ پرش کمتر، همه به الگوریتم های گوگل می گوید آن صفحه برای کاربران مفید است. علاوه بر این:
صفحات سریع تر توسط کراولرها بهتر ایندکس می شوند (سرور سریع تر اجازه می دهد کراولر صفحات بیشتری را بخواند).
تجربه کاربری مثبت منجر به اشتراک گذاری و لینک سازی ارگانیک می شود که فاکتور مهم سئوست.
چک لیست نهایی برای بررسی سریع
تست با PageSpeed Insights و WebPageTest انجام شده است.
LCP زیر 2.5 ثانیه، FID/INP مناسب و CLS کمتر از 0.1.
CDN فعال و تصاویر بهینه شده اند.
کش مرورگر و فشرده سازی فعال است.
فایل های CSS/JS مینیمال و بارگذاری غیرضروری به تعویق افتاده است.
پلاگین ها و اسکریپت های سنگین حذف یا بهینه شده اند.
فونت ها بهینه و از preload برای فونت های ضروری استفاده شده است.
جمع بندی
سرعت سایت دیگر یک گزینه لوکس نیست؛ یک ضرورت است. سرعت خوب تجربه کاربری را ارتقا می دهد، نرخ تبدیل را افزایش می دهد و در بلندمدت تاثیر مثبتی روی سئو و موقعیت در نتایج جستجو خواهد داشت. همین امروز با اندازه گیری وضعیت فعلی شروع شده و بر اساس اولویت های ذکرشده قدم های عملی بردارید. بهینه سازی سرعت، یک سرمایه گذاری مداوم است که پاداشش در افزایش رضایت کاربران و رشد کسب وکار به سرعت ظاهر می شود.
نکته عملی کوتاه: شروع با تصاویر و کش سرور معمولاً سریع ترین بازگشت سرمایه را دارد. تنظیمات کوچک در این دو بخش اغلب بیشترین تاثیر را به همراه دارد.